I have two of these. They are the easiest to install. Fan controller is built in. LED light is one assembly that you plug in. Fan blades press into the their posts with ease and simplicity. On high mode this moves a lot of air but produces a lot of wind noise. On the lowest setting it's very quiet. You might be able to hear a slightly audible hum but it didn't bother me. BTW, I've never came across a completely silent fan, and I've installed plenty.
